Decapitated body found under bridge

January 22, 2015 12:00 am | Updated 10:07 am IST - CHENNAI:

A headless corpse was discovered in a bush near Basin Bridge railway station on Wednesday morning.

The police have identified the deceased to be a Pulianthope-based autorickshaw driver who went missing on January 13.

According to the Basin Bridge police, the highly decomposed body of a man, with the right hand missing, was found by a police team after locals complained of foul smell emanating from under the bridge.

“We suspect the victim was murdered and the body dumped there more than a week ago. A case of murder has been registered,” said an investigating officer attached to the Basin Bridge police on Wednesday afternoon.

By evening, the police found out a man was reported missing at the Pulianthope police station on January 14. The complainant, Bhagyalakshmi of Kannikapuram in Pulianthope, identified the body to be that of her son Prabhakaran (25), an autorickshaw driver.

On January 13, the victim returned from a pilgrimage to Sabarimala and was last seen with some friends near his house. His phone remained switched off and he couldn’t be located afterwards following which Bhagyalakshmi approached the police.

The Basin Bridge police are now probing the murder and questioning the victim’s friends. It is suspected a longstanding rivalry with some locals resulted in Prabhakaran’s murder.
